Tugas 3 Muhammad Attaritsabitsah Gibran
Muhammad Attaritsabitsah Gibran
1806202443
Permasalahan
Analisis Masalah
Sebuah benda bermassa m dipasangkan dengan sebuah pegas dengan nilai k. Kemudian benda tersebut diberikan gaya sebesar P(t), sedangkan P(t) memiliki beberapa kondisi yang perlu diamati. Diberikan juga sebuah persamaan diferensial sebagai jalannya benda terhadap pegas. Bila diketahui massa benda 2,5 kg dan k adalah 75 N/m dan gaya gesek diabaikan. Dengan menggunakan metode Runge-Kutta 4 orde, akan dicari sebuah perpindahan terjauh.
Penyelesaian
Persamaan awal diferensial diketahui adalah persamaan diferensial ke-2. Karena itu, kita mencari persamaan awal y dengan cara integrate menggunakan Runge-Kutta. Dengan memberikan variabel berupa x, y, target x, dan h (range iterasi). Dengan runge-kutta 4, maka sesuai kaidah mendefinisikan Runge-Kutta 4 dengan K0, K1, K2, K3 untuk dicari rata-rata K.
Kemudian mendefinisikan persamaan esensial P(t). Definisi tersebut sesuai dengan soal. Selanjutnya mendefinisikan persamaan diferensial benda, sebagai persamaan turunan.
Menyimpan nilai-nilai yang diketahui seperti massa benda, nilai k pegas, t(0) dan t(target). Penentuan t(target) adalah bebas atau tidak diberi batasan oleh soal. Serta step iterasi h, yang juga tidak dibatasi.
Kemudian plotting yang sepenuhnya diserahkan kepada matplotlib.
Hasil
Hasil yang diberikan berbentuk list, dan plot titik untuk melihat perilaku pegas terhadap benda m. Maka dapat diambil nilai tertinggi adalah sekitar pada x = 2,4 second, dengan nilai y = 0,273...
Komentar
Menurut saya hasil yang diberikan cukup merepresentasikan perilaku pegas terhadap benda, terutama pada visualisasi matplotlib. Saya cukup puas dengan hasil yang diberikan. Terutama penggunaan Runge-Kutta yang ternyata sangat mudah bila di selesaikan secara metode numerik. Dibandingkan dengan secara manual.
Evaluasi
Saya masih belum mengerti secara mendalam konsep Runge-Kutta
Kembali ke halaman awal Muhammad Attaritsabitsah Gibran